Puppy chow is a snack mix made of crunchy chex cereal coated in a mixture of chocolate chips, peanut butter, butter, and vanilla which is covered in powered sugar. Of course we used all dairy-free ingredients in this recipe, but I also included options to use gluten-free rice squares cereal (many brands are gluten free) and sunflower seed butter for a snack mix that is also gluten-free and nut-free.
